A sharp density increase(referred to as density incrustation)of the Au plasmas in the radiative cooling process of high-Z Au plasmas confined by low-Z CH plasmas is found through the radiative hydrodynamic *** temperature of Au plasmas changes obviously in the cooling layer while the pressure remains ***,the Au plasmas in the cooling layer are compressed,and the density incrustation is *** is also shown that when the high-Z plasma opacity decreases or the low-Z plasma opacity increases,the peak density of the density incrustation becomes lower and the thickness of the density incrustation becomes *** phenomenon is crucial to the Ray-leigheTaylor instability at the interface of high-Z and low-Z plasmas,since the density variation of Au plasmas has a considerable influence on the Atwood number of the interface.

Numerical simulation is a powerful tool to get insight into the physics of laser fusion. Much effort has been devoted to develop the numerical simulation code series named LARED in China. The code series LARED are composed of six parts and enable us to have the simulation capability for the key processes in laser fusion. In recent years, a number of numerical simulations using LARED have been carried out and the simulation is checked by experiments done at the laser facility SG‐II and SG‐III prototype. In the present talk, some details of LARED code series will be introduced, and some simulation results, especially recent work on the opacities, will be shown.
